Necessity is the mother of invention. Most guys that were big since they were little do have the same opportunity to develop some of these skills but they just never have to in order to dominate, so they develop skills that increase how dominant they can be in the areas in which they are already having so much success. Also getting low enough to the ground that your dribble won't get tipped away is not as easy for big guys as it is for smaller players... so an efficient handle is a little harder for a big to develop. Passing should be easier for them to develop but again when scoring at the hoop comes so naturally why would you pass it a lot.
